Hosting your website on a local server can significantly enhance your WordPress experience. When you operate your website from South African servers, you gain various advantages that can impact both performance and user experience. As you consider your hosting options, the geographical location of the server plays a vital role in the overall efficiency and speed of your website.

One of the primary benefits of local website hosting is reduced latency. When your website is hosted on South African servers, the data travels a shorter distance to reach your users. This lowers the time it takes for your pages to load, resulting in faster response times. For South African visitors, this can mean the difference between staying on your site or leaving for a competitor. Speed is an necessary factor in user retention and satisfaction.

Additionally, using local hosting can improve your website’s SEO rankings. Search engines consider server location as one of the factors in determining the relevance of your site to local users. When users search for services or products, searches are often tailored to geographical locations. Hosting your website locally gives you an edge in local search engine results, making it easier for potential customers to find your business online.

Local website hosting can also enhance the reliability of your service. South African servers typically adhere to local regulations and standards, which can lead to better service levels. You are less likely to face issues related to international bandwidth limitations or regulations. Furthermore, local providers often offer tailored support, understanding your specific needs as a South African business, which can be more accessible and responsive compared to international hosts.

Your audience will most likely consist of South Africans, so having a hosting solution that caters specifically to your market will provide better overall customer experiences. You can benefit from localized content delivery networks (CDNs) which can further enhance loading speeds across the country. This ensures that your website remains accessible and efficient for your users, regardless of their location in South Africa.

Security is another vital area where local website hosting can matter significantly. By hosting your WordPress site on local servers, you may have improved access to compliance with South African data protection laws, including the Protection of Personal Information Act (POPIA). Local hosting providers are more equipped to help you navigate these regulations, ensuring that your website stays compliant while protecting your users’ data.

In the context of cost, local hosting can also present financial benefits. While there may be some premium options, many local providers offer competitive pricing that can be more affordable when you factor in bandwidth and performance outcomes. You also avoid potential hidden costs associated with foreign transactional fees that may arise with international hosting solutions.

All things considered, local website hosting in South Africa can provide you with improved speed, better SEO performance, enhanced reliability, and security tailored to your market. Assessing the hosting solutions available within your country can ensure that your WordPress site operates efficiently and meets the needs of your local audience.
